Understanding Your Acer Predator X32 FP

The Acer Predator X32 FP is a high-end gaming monitor designed for enthusiasts who demand exceptional visuals. It features a 32-inch 4K UHD display, a 144Hz refresh rate, and a 160Hz overclocked mode. To unlock its full potential, it’s crucial to understand its key features and settings.

Enabling Overclocked Mode

To unlock the 160Hz refresh rate, navigate to the monitor's on-screen display (OSD) menu. Locate the 'Overclock' setting and enable it. This will provide smoother gameplay and reduce motion blur.

Optimizing Display Settings

Adjust the display settings for the best visual experience. Use the following guidelines:

  • Color Mode: Select 'Gaming' or 'Custom' for vibrant colors.
  • Brightness and Contrast: Set brightness around 250-300 nits and contrast to 70-80%.
  • Response Time: Set to 'Fast' or 'Fastest' for minimal input lag.

Adjusting G-SYNC and FreeSync

If your graphics card supports G-SYNC or FreeSync, enable these features in your GPU control panel and the monitor's OSD. This reduces screen tearing and provides smoother gameplay.

Troubleshooting Common Issues

If you experience issues such as flickering, color inaccuracies, or input lag, try the following:

  • Reset the monitor to factory settings.
  • Reinstall or update your graphics drivers.
  • Check cable connections and replace HDMI or DisplayPort cables if necessary.
  • Disable any conflicting display settings in your GPU control panel.
